Design Quality Engineer
Broughton
A new opportunity has arisen for a Design Quality Engineer to join the Quality Engineering Airframe organisation at Broughton site. Reporting to the Head of Quality Engineering Wing Operations, you will play a pivotal role in ensuring quality performance across all programmes, working closely with Engineering teams and suppliers across Europe, America, and Asia.
Role Overview:
As a Design Quality Engineer, you will be responsible for resolving quality issues and driving continuous improvement projects. Your focus will be on setting measurement standards, identifying and facilitating improvements to enhance process performance, and ensuring product adherence to standards. You will work proactively at the initial design phase, before process changes are made, and continue to support quality throughout the product lifecycle.
Key Responsibilities:
* Deploy the Quality Strategy within the Engineering Wing organisation through the implementation of Quality Improvement Projects and Plans.
* Lead and deliver improvement projects to achieve Engineering Wing quality targets.
* Facilitate and support root cause analysis and practical problem-solving activities.
* Establish, drive, and monitor corrective and preventive action plans to improve engineering quality performance.
* Identify and mitigate risks/issues related to engineering deliverables, supporting standardised mitigation plans.
* Support the deployment and application of Quality standards within the Engineering organisation.
* Capture and share lessons learned to enhance organisational efficiency and product maturity.
